Ethereum Hits New High as Expected, but Volatility Sends Warning Signals
In early August, after Ethereum surged past 4000 with strong momentum, we predicted that bulls would inevitably need to push for a new high. Last week, following Powell’s comments hinting at rate cuts, ETH quickly rallied and ultimately surpassed the late 2021 peak. However, numerous indicators suggest this breakout and new high may not be solid, pointing to a risk of a bull trap.The first signal we focus on is the Average True Range (ATR) volatility indicator. Unlike many assets, Ethereum’s price moves show a clear positive correlation with ATR, indicating ETH behaves more like a cyclical commodity than a pure risk asset like U.S. stocks. Alibaba Earnings Face-Off: Food Delivery War or AI Capex to Drive the Surge?
$Alibaba(BABA)$ Alibaba Group is on the brink of its Q2 2025 earnings release on August 29, 2025, with market eyes locked on whether its food delivery battles or AI infrastructure investments will steer the stock higher. Analysts forecast revenue of RMB 266 billion (+9.4% YoY), driven by e-commerce and cloud growth, but adjusted EBITA of RMB 35.3 billion (-21.7% YoY) reflects heavy capex in AI amid competition from Pinduoduo and ByteDance's Ele.me. With the S&P 500 at 6,466.58, Bitcoin at $115,000, and oil at $75/barrel under 30-35% tariffs, the VIX at 14.49 signals calm, but Alibaba's RSI at 55 suggests room for movement.
